ACCIDENTSAND FATALITIES.

A SEAMAN'S DEATH. (Pee United Pbess Association.) GISBORNE, December 19. Axel Petersen, a seaman, whose spina was’injured during wbol loading j operations at Waipiro Bay, died on Monday. James Williams, 20 years of age, who resides at 62a South road, Caversham, was admitted to the Hospital yesterday suffering from injuries to his chest and arm, caused through the breaking of a sling used for lifting Burning pipes at the Dunedin Engineering Works. Williams was struck by & falling pip©. DROWNING FATALITY FEARED. (Pee United Pbess Association.) NEW 1 PLYMOUTH. December 19. It is* feared that a drowning fatality occurred at Kotare (Mokau district) to-day. 4 farm lad named Reginald O Donnell, l 6 years, rode into a flooded river, and is believed to have been washed off his horse. The body has not yet been found.
